Default B&M short shifter PART # 45047 Installation question?

So when installing this shifter does the bend face the driver or does the main bend face away from the driver. When installing these types of shifters can you install them backwards or do they only install one way?

Default Re: B&M short shifter PART # 45047 Installation question? (Delano5050)

the bend should be facing towards the back of the car and yes it can be installed backwards i had it on my hatch like that for few weeks was too lazy to switch it back around
